Transaction fb761471aef6a34251050ea06c18dcc106bf9cf364da06e2c6090213122ee126
1 Input
1 Output
-
fb761471aef6a34251050ea06c18dcc106bf9cf364da06e2c6090213122ee126:0
- value
- 865524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7601338f0e2bf69901ffcd6de811572750f44c9 OP_EQUAL
- address
- 3MKpJCdnqxEvMk4rE3g73GRHqv8KS4yUD2